Financial Considerations

For most of us financing our new home means getting a mortgage. This is one of the most important areas of the purchase to resolve as early as possible. You should start out by correcting wherever possible any flaws in your credit that can be legally removed. Contact me for advice on how to do this.

It is important you get your credit in good shape and keep it that way throughout the home buying process. Do not make any major purchases or allow anyone to "pull" your credit report until you have moved into your new home. The process of allowing someone to examine your credit report will lower your credit rating, even if you do not make a purchase.

The next stage is to determine how much home you can comfortably afford and will get loan approval for. Successful mortgage qualification will be much easier if you start saving those extra pennies right away. Remember if you need a mortgage, the value of the home you can purchase will depend upon your income, debts and down payment.
